Elementary Engineering - Fracture Mechanics
The book contains two major parts, 1) the PRICIPLES, and 2) the APPLICATIONS. Users of this book will find advanced procedures and have general understanding of the elementary concepts, which are provided by this volume. The emphasis was placed on the practical application of fracture mechanics, but it was aimed to treat the subject in a way that may interest both metallurgists and engineers. This is considered suitable for advanced undergraduate or first year graduate students. But it may also serve as a general introduction to this relatively new discipline for engineers and metallurgists who have not been confronted earlier with fracture mechanics. It is the aim of this book to show the use and application of fracture mechanics to practical problems.
